The Importance of Seating & Posture for Wheelchair Users

Seating and posture are key for wheelchair users – something that’s often overlooked when choosing the right set up.

A wheelchair is not just a mode of transportation, but also an extension of a person’s body. A comfortable and supportive wheelchair seat can make all the difference in the world.

Why is seating and posture so important?

There are many reasons why seating and posture are important for people using wheelchairs. First and foremost, good posture helps prevent discomfort and pain. Prolonged periods of sitting in an uncomfortable position can lead to pressure sores, which can be both painful and difficult to treat. In addition, poor posture can lead to back and neck pain, which can be debilitating in its own right.

Furthermore, good posture can improve overall health and well-being. It can aid in breathing, digestion, and even help prevent muscle atrophy. When a person’s posture is aligned properly, their body functions more efficiently, allowing them to have more energy and less pain and discomfort.

Seating, posture and stability

And an often overlooked factor too is stability. A well-designed wheelchair that promotes good posture provides stability, helping them maintain balance and control. Proper seating and positioning can also help prevent falls and accidents, which can be dangerous and potentially life-threatening.

It’s also worth noting that seating and posture can have a significant impact on a person’s social and emotional well-being. Being comfortable and confident in one’s wheelchair can make it easier to participate in social activities and reducing fears about being mobile. 

Making the right choices

So, what can be done to ensure good seating and posture for people using wheelchairs? Well, it’s really important not only to work with a healthcare professional or rehabilitation specialist to assess your specific needs, but to use the information from those assessments to select the right products for your needs, from customised seating and positioning solutions to the actual wheelchair itself. 

Once you have the right fit for you, it’s really important to have regular check-ins and adjustments to the wheelchair and your seating to ensure your comfort and posture remain optimal over time. 

Additionally, it’s worth noting that your body will change and adapt over time, and as it does so you’ll need to adjust your equipment accordingly.
